BILDERDIJK, WILLEM

найдено в "Historical Dictionary of the Netherlands"

(1756–1831)
   Poet and historian. Bilderdijk studied law at Leiden University and acquired fame as the legal de fender of certain Orangistagitators who were prosecuted by the new Patriot rulers in the 1780s. After the Restoration, Bilderdijk did not receive the post as professor that he thought he deserved. He lived in Leiden as an independent scholar, organizing collegia privatissima on Dutch history for interested young students. As a critic of ration alism, he influenced young men such as the Calvinists Guillaume Groen van Prinsterer and Isaac da Costa, who were to play an im portant role in Christian politics and cultural life.
